How much does a Houston Medical Center X Ray Tech make?

As of March 2025, the average annual salary for a X Ray Tech at Houston Medical Center is $63,600, which translates to approximately $31 per hour. Salaries for X Ray Tech at Houston Medical Center typically range from $58,438 to $68,965, reflecting the diverse roles within the company.

Headquartered in Warner Robins, Georgia, Houston Healthcare is a healthcare system with multilple entitities. Provided services include surgeries, urgent care, physiciatric care, orthopedics, and more.
